Success! Decoded 'QRZ' at Cumiana (IK1QFK) with Eb/N0 = +0.4 dB, BER 41.6%; S/N -31.7 dB in 1Hz, -65.7 dB in 2.5kHz (after sferic blanking); List rank 5689, constant reference phase; Distance is 7173
At Bielefeld (6917.7 km): Eb/N0 -3.3 dB; At Warsaw (7681.3 km): Eb/N0 -6.5 dB; At Hawley TX (1816.2 km): Eb/N0 +5.7 dB *Decoded*; The decode at Hawley is a new USA record distance for VLF message dec
